I agree with IBKLEEN you really need to speak to a Dr. If you werent getting your lortab from a Dr and off the streets you still need to talk to a Dr and ASAP. Don't take any advise from anyone in this group that tells you how to taper while your pregnant. IT IS VERY DANGEROUS TO WITHDRAWAL WHILE PREGNANT. You can have a lot of complications if you withdrawal while pregnant one being miscarriage. Don't be ashamed to tell your Dr about the lortab. Tell your Dr if not for you do it for the health of your baby.

No one here could help you with a schedule, especially since you are pregnant. There are no doctors here and it would be dangerous for anyone to tell you how to taper.

You need to speak with your doctor and let him/her help you. If it is not your OBGYN that prescribed the Lortab, you still need to speak with them as well. They may tell you not to taper or they may help you with a plan. Either way, both doctors (if there are two) need to know.
